Follow these instructions carefully in order to confirm participation in CSL Season 5:
- Reply to this email with the following: "We, [school name], are committed to playing in CSL Season 5 (Fall 2011-Spring 2012) with fewer than two match forfeits." This means that you are 100% certain you will have a team of 5 unique players by Thursday, September 15 who can participate in at least 18 weeks of play.
- Read the rules carefully and reply: "We have read and agree to follow all the rules."
- Rank your preferences for match times. Tell us which match times you ABSOLUTELY CANNOT make (i.e. Sundays for religious schools). Please be flexible and we will try our best as well!
- Request any teams that you think are absolutely necessary to put in your division (based on rivalries, etc).
Thursday (6pm PST || 9pm EST)
Friday (6pm PST || 9pm EST)
Saturday (1pm PST || 4 pm EST) (5pm PST || 8pm EST)
Sunday (1pm PST || 4 pm EST) (5pm PST || 8pm EST)
**A little background on this: this season, we will have four playdays (Thursday, Friday, Saturday, Sunday). Teams will be grouped according to the following priorities: (1) geographical location, (2) balance, (3) preferred time slot, and (4) traditional rivalries/requests. We will do our best to accommodate teams, but with over 250 registered schools it is likely that you won't get your first or second choice.
You must email cstarleague@gmail.com with the above information no later than September 7, 11:59pm EST. Title your email: "S5 CONFIRMATION."
Important Events and Deadlines
August 31, 8pm EST: Map and Format Discussion - Join us for a live discussion of this season's map pool and format.
September 5: Season 5 Details released
September 7, 8pm EST: Season 5 Q&A - Q&A about rules, format, schedule, and anything else you ever wanted to know about the upcoming season.
September 9: CONFIRMATION DEADLINE
September 10: Divisions released - Divisions and match schedules for this season are released.
September 15-19: Week 1 of Matches
